The global smart band market is experiencing robust growth, driven by increasing health consciousness, the affordability of devices, and the integration of advanced features. The market, estimated at $15 billion in 2025, is projected to grow at a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 12% from 2025 to 2033, reaching approximately $40 billion by 2033. This expansion is fueled by several key factors. Firstly, the rising prevalence of chronic diseases and a growing focus on preventative healthcare are boosting demand for wearable fitness trackers. Secondly, technological advancements such as improved sensor technology, enhanced battery life, and the incorporation of features like contactless payments and sleep monitoring are making smart bands more appealing to consumers. Finally, the increasing penetration of smartphones and readily available mobile applications enhances the functionality and user experience of smart bands, expanding their appeal beyond fitness enthusiasts to a broader consumer base. Major players like Fitbit, Garmin, Samsung, and Xiaomi dominate the market, constantly innovating to cater to diverse consumer needs and preferences. However, the market faces challenges such as intense competition, the potential for product commoditization, and concerns around data privacy and security. To overcome these hurdles, companies are focusing on developing unique value propositions through advanced health analytics, personalized fitness coaching, and seamless integration with other health and wellness platforms. Market segmentation is crucial, with variations in design, features, and pricing catering to different target demographics and budgets. The Asia-Pacific region is expected to witness significant growth, driven by increasing disposable incomes and rising adoption of technology in developing economies. Future growth will depend on the continuous evolution of smart band technology, the development of innovative features, and effective marketing strategies that highlight the benefits and value proposition of these devices.

The Fitness Tracker Market size was valued at USD 52.29 Billion in 2024 and is projected to reach USD 189.98 Billion by 2032, growing at a CAGR of 17.50% from 2026 to 2032.
Key Market Drivers
Increasing Health Awareness: According to the World Health Organization (WHO), global obesity has nearly tripled since 1975, with 39% of adults overweight in 2016. This health crisis is pushing more people towards fitness monitoring. Growing awareness about fitness and preventive healthcare drives the adoption of fitness trackers.
Technological Advancements: According to the Pew Research Center, 85% of Americans owned a smartphone in 2021, up from 35% in 2011, providing a strong foundation for fitness tracker integration. Integration of advanced features like ECG monitoring, SpO2 tracking, and GPS enhances product appeal.

The global fitness bands market size was valued at USD 7.2 billion in 2023 and is projected to reach USD 18.5 billion by 2032, growing at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 11.1% from 2024 to 2032. The market growth is primarily driven by increasing health consciousness and advancements in wearable technology. With the rising prevalence of lifestyle diseases and a growing geriatric population, fitness bands have become an essential tool for monitoring health and wellness, further propelling market growth.
One of the primary growth factors for the fitness bands market is the increasing awareness about health and fitness among the global population. As people become more conscious about the benefits of maintaining a healthy lifestyle, there is a growing demand for devices that can assist in tracking and improving physical activity. Fitness bands, with their ability to monitor various health metrics such as heart rate, steps taken, calories burned, and sleep patterns, cater to this need effectively. Additionally, the integration of advanced features such as GPS tracking, waterproof designs, and long battery life make these devices even more appealing to consumers.
Technological advancements in wearable devices are another significant driver of market growth. Companies are continuously innovating to enhance the functionality and user experience of fitness bands. The incorporation of art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ning algorithms allows these devices to provide more accurate and personalized health insights. Moreover, the development of hybrid fitness bands that combine traditional wristwatch designs with modern fitness tracking features has widened the target audience, attracting not just fitness enthusiasts but also casual users and fashion-conscious individuals.
The rise of the Internet of Things (IoT) and increased smartphone penetration have also contributed to the expansion of the fitness bands market. With seamless connectivity features, fitness bands can now sync with smartphones and other smart devices, providing users with real-time data and comprehensive health reports. This integration enhances user engagement by offering features such as social sharing, goal setting, and virtual coaching. Moreover, the availability of fitness band applications on various operating systems, including iOS and Android, ensures compatibility and ease of use for a broad range of consumers.
In terms of regional outlook, the Asia Pacific region is expected to witness significant growth in the fitness bands market. The region's large population base, increasing disposable incomes, and growing awareness about health and fitness are key factors driving market expansion. North America and Europe are also major markets, owing to the high adoption rates of wearable technology and a well-established fitness culture. Latin America, the Middle East, and Africa are anticipated to experience moderate growth, driven by urbanization and increasing health consciousness in these regions.

The global smart band market size is projected to experience robust growth, with an estimated value of $13.2 billion in 2023, expected to reach approximately $34.8 billion by 2032, showcasing a compelling comp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 11.2%. This growth trajectory is underpinned by a confluence of factors, including increasing health awareness, technological advancements, and the proliferation of the Internet of Things (IoT) devices. As consumers become more health-conscious, the demand for smart bands, which provide real-time health and fitness data, is growing significantly. The market is set to expand further as manufacturers integrate more advanced features and functionalities into smart bands, catering to a diverse range of consumer needs.
One of the primary growth drivers of the smart band market is the increasing emphasis on health and fitness among consumers globally. As lifestyle diseases such as obesity, diabetes, and cardiovascular conditions become more prevalent, individuals are seeking ways to monitor their health metrics continuously. Smart bands offer a convenient solution, allowing users to track vital signs like heart rate, steps taken, calories burned, and even sleep patterns with a high degree of accuracy. This growing health consciousness is not only prevalent in developed countries but is also becoming more widespread in emerging economies, thereby expanding the market's reach. Furthermore, the integration of advanced sensors and AI-driven analytics in smart bands enhances their functionality, making them indispensable tools for personal health management.
Technological advancements in wearable technology are another critical factor driving the growth of the smart band market. Innovations in sensor technology have enabled the development of more sophisticated smart bands that can monitor a wide range of health metrics with greater precision. The advent of flexible and stretchable electronics has also allowed manufacturers to design more comfortable and aesthetically pleasing devices. Additionally, the integration of AI and machine learning algorithms into smart bands has enhanced their ability to provide personalized insights and recommendations, further increasing their appeal. As technology continues to evolve, the functionality and utility of smart bands are expected to expand, attracting a broader consumer base.
The growing penetration of smartphones and the expansion of digital ecosystems are also contributing to the smart band market's growth. As more consumers adopt smartphones, the ability of smart bands to sync seamlessly with mobile devices becomes a significant selling point. This connectivity allows users to access their health data conveniently and make informed decisions about their wellness routines. Moreover, the development of comprehensive digital health platforms and applications has created an ecosystem that supports the use of smart bands, further driving consumer adoption. The increasing availability of Internet connectivity, particularly in developing regions, is also facilitating the widespread use of smart bands, enabling users to access real-time data and insights regardless of their location.
Regionally, Asia Pacific is anticipated to lead the smart band market in terms of growth rate, driven by the region's large population base, rapid urbanization, and increasing disposable income. The rising popularity of fitness and wellness trends in countries like China and India is a significant factor contributing to the regional market's expansion. In North America and Europe, the adoption of smart bands is expected to remain strong, supported by advanced healthcare systems and a tech-savvy population. Meanwhile, the markets in Latin America and the Middle East & Africa are also poised for growth, albeit at a more gradual pace, as awareness and infrastructure continue to develop. Each of these regions presents unique opportunities and challenges that will shape the dynamics of the smart band market in the coming years.

The global smart wearable band market size is projected to grow from USD 25 billion in 2023 to an estimated USD 45 billion by 2032, exhibiting a robust comp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of approximately 6.5% during the forecast period. This growth is driven by a confluence of factors, including technological advancements, rising consumer health consciousness, and increasing integration of AI technology in wearable devices. The evolving consumer lifestyle preferences and a burgeoning demand for real-time health data analytics are pivotal in propelling the market's expansion. As these devices continue to enhance their functionalities, their adoption across diverse sectors is broadening, thus creating a fertile environment for significant market growth.
One of the primary growth factors in the smart wearable band market is the escalating consumer emphasis on health and fitness. With the increasing prevalence of lifestyle-related diseases and the global rise in health awareness, there is a notable surge in demand for devices that can monitor and track fitness metrics. Consumers are increasingly inclined towards maintaining a healthy lifestyle, which has led to a growing adoption of fitness bands that provide real-time insights into physical activities, sleep patterns, and heart rate monitoring. Additionally, the integration of advanced sensors and health metrics in these bands is enhancing their capability to monitor more complex health parameters, thereby attracting a broader consumer base.
Another significant driver is the rapid technological advancements in the wearable technology domain. The seamless convergence of wearable technology with the Internet of Things (IoT) and Artificial Intelligence (AI) is transforming the wearable bands into smart devices capable of delivering personalized health and fitness solutions. The ability to sync data seamlessly with smartphones and other smart devices enhances the user experience, thereby boosting the adoption rate. Furthermore, the introduction of innovative functionalities such as contactless payment, GPS tracking, and music playback is making these devices more appealing to tech-savvy consumers, thus driving market growth.
The proliferation of smart wearable bands is also accelerated by the growing trend of digitalization in healthcare. The healthcare sector's increasing reliance on wearable technology for patient monitoring and management is contributing to the market's expansion. These bands are becoming essential tools for healthcare providers to track patient health metrics remotely, ensuring timely interventions and personalized care plans. The data-driven insights provided by these devices are invaluable in chronic disease management, making them indispensable in modern healthcare settings. This trend is expected to continue as healthcare systems increasingly prioritize preventive care and remote monitoring solutions.
Regionally, North America holds a dominant position in the smart wearable band market, driven by high consumer disposable income, advanced technological infrastructure, and a large base of tech-savvy consumers. The region's robust healthcare system further supports the adoption of health monitoring devices. However, the Asia Pacific region is anticipated to witness the highest growth rate, with a CAGR of approximately 8%, largely attributed to the rising middle-class population, increasing health awareness, and rapid urbanization. European markets are also projected to experience steady growth, supported by strong government initiatives promoting digital health solutions. Meanwhile, Latin America and the Middle East & Africa, though smaller in market size, are expected to witness gradual growth due to increasing penetration of smart technology and improving economic conditions.

The global smartbands market size was valued at approximately USD 18.7 billion in 2023 and is projected to reach around USD 42.1 billion by 2032, growing at a CAGR of 9.6% from 2024 to 2032. This significant growth can be attributed to the increasing adoption of health and fitness tracking devices among a health-conscious population and the ongoing technological advancements that enhance the functionality and user experience of smartbands.
One of the primary growth factors driving the smartbands market is the rising awareness regarding health and fitness. The global population is becoming increasingly health-conscious, and individuals are investing in smartbands to monitor their daily physical activities, sleep patterns, and overall health metrics. The integration of advanced sensors and monitoring technologies in smartbands allows users to track their heart rate, blood oxygen levels, and even stress levels, thereby providing a holistic view of their health. This growing trend towards personal health management is expected to continue propelling the market forward.
Another critical driver for the smartbands market is the continuous innovation and development in wearable technology. Companies are focusing on enhancing the features and functionalities of smartbands, such as extending battery life, improving data accuracy, and incorporating more advanced health monitoring capabilities. The integration of artificial intelligence and machine learning algorithms into smartbands has revolutionized their ability to provide personalized health insights and recommendations. Additionally, the development of hybrid bands that combine traditional watch features with smart capabilities is attracting a broader consumer base.
The increasing penetration of smartphones and the internet across the globe is also playing a crucial role in the growth of the smartbands market. The seamless connectivity between smartbands and smartphones allows users to sync their health data, receive notifications, and access a wide range of applications. This connectivity enhances the user experience and makes smartbands an integral part of the digital ecosystem. Moreover, the affordability of smartbands has improved, making them accessible to a larger demographic, which further fuels market growth.
Regionally, North America holds a significant share of the global smartbands market, driven by high consumer awareness, robust healthcare infrastructure, and a strong presence of key market players. The Asia Pacific region is anticipated to witness the highest growth rate during the forecast period, attributed to the rising disposable incomes, increasing urbanization, and growing health awareness among consumers. Europe also represents a substantial market share, supported by favorable government initiatives promoting digital health and fitness solutions.
The smartbands market can be segmented by product type into fitness bands, sports bands, hybrid bands, and others. Fitness bands are the most popular type of smartbands, primarily used for tracking daily physical activities and monitoring health metrics such as steps taken, calories burned, and sleep patterns. These bands are widely adopted by health-conscious individuals and fitness enthusiasts who aim to maintain an active lifestyle. The continuous development in sensor technology and the integration of advanced health monitoring features are expected to drive the demand for fitness bands in the coming years.
Sports bands are specifically designed for athletes and sports professionals to monitor their performance and enhance their training routines. These bands come equipped with specialized sensors that can track various sports activities such as running, cycling, and swimming. The increasing popularity of sports and fitness activities, coupled with the growing demand for performance tracking devices, is expected to boost the growth of the sports bands segment. Additionally, partnerships between sports equipment manufacturers and wearable technology companies are likely to introduce innovative sports bands with advanced functionalities.
Hybrid bands combine the features of traditional watches with smart functionalities. These bands cater to consumers who prefer the classic look of a watch but also want the benefits of health and fitness tracking. Hybrid bands are gaining traction due to their stylish designs, extended battery life, and versatile functionalities.
